Description
The Fluke 1625-2 Advanced GEO Earth Ground Tester is a highly dependable and efficient device utilized for assessing the ground resistance of electrical systems. It is specifically designed with advanced features and capabilities that make it an indispensable tool for electricians, contractors, and maintenance professionals. This tester employs the 3- and 4-pole fall-of-potential, earth resistance measurement technique, as well as the selective earth ground rod testing method, to provide precise and accurate results. With a large, user-friendly display and an intuitive interface, the Fluke 1625-2 simplifies the testing process and ensures quick and effortless operation. Furthermore, it offers extensive memory storage, enabling users to save and retrieve up to 1500 records. Built with a sturdy construction and a robust design, this earth ground tester is engineered to endure harsh environmental conditions and consistently deliver high performance in various industries and applications. In conclusion, the Fluke 1625-2 Advanced GEO Earth Ground Tester is a reliable and trusted tool that guarantees the safety and dependability of electrical systems through comprehensive ground resistance testing.
Specifications
– Measures earth ground loop resistances ranging from 0.025 Ω to 1500 Ω
– Measures earth ground potentials from 0 to 100 V
– Measures earth ground resistance using the 3-pole Fall of Potential method
– Measures earth ground resistance using the 2-pole Soil Resistivity method
– Measures earth ground resistance using the 4-pole Soil Resistivity method
– Measures earth ground impedance using the Stakeless method (without disconnecting the earth electrode)
– Measures earth ground resistivity using the 4-pole Wenner method
– Generates AC voltage output for testing AC voltage systems
– Offers selectable frequencies for testing specific applications (94 Hz, 105 Hz, 111 Hz, and 128 Hz)
– Features a large LCD screen for clear and easy-to-read measurements
– Includes a built-in memory for storing up to 1500 records
– Offers USB connectivity for data transfer to a computer
– Comes with a rugged carrying case for easy transportation and protection
